The file (commonly formatted as xf-adsk2017_x64.exe ) is widely identified by security platforms as a malicious keygen or crack tool used to illegally activate Autodesk software like AutoCAD 2017. While users often search for it to bypass licensing fees, it poses severe security risks, including malware infection and system instability. What is xfadsk2017x64exe?

The file is a 64-bit executable created to generate product activation keys for Autodesk software from the 2017 release cycle. An identical 32-bit version, xf-adsk2017_x86.exe , also exists. A typical keygen is usually bundled with both 32‑bit and 64‑bit executables, where the file name indicates the target year (“2017”) and architecture (“x64”). Because keygens are used to defeat copy protection, they are almost never distributed through official channels. Instead, they are shared on file‑hosting sites, forums, and peer‑to‑peer networks, which raises serious security concerns.
